Heres the deal:

I gotta move my computer to another place because there is some work going on in my house and it cannot be used where it is right now. I have a broadband internet connection and the cable isnt long enough to reach the new place. What can I do so I can connect it to the Internet? I thought about getting another cable and connecting an end to the broadband cable and the other end to the computer.

Also, whats the name of the broadband port/cable?

    ++ [ originally posted by fabiana ] ++


    Yes, like a phone cable but the end to connect it to the computer is wider
    yeah... if that's the type of cable you want to get an extension for, then you can. any computer hardware store should have longer cables and adapters to conncect multiple cables together.

    That cable is called an RJ-45. and you can get an adapter for it to connect another one. :)
